History of LED Tubes

The concept of LED Tubes can be traced back to the early days of LED technology. LEDs, or Light Emitting Diodes, were first discovered in the 1920s, but it wasn't until the 1960s that they began to be used as a light source. Initially, LEDs were small and expensive, making them suitable only for niche applications such as indicator lights and displays. However, as technology advanced, the cost of producing LEDs decreased, and their efficiency and lifespan improved, leading to their widespread adoption in various industries.

In the 1990s, the development of high-brightness LEDs (HB-LEDs) further propelled the growth of LED technology. HB-LEDs emitted more light than traditional LEDs, making them viable for general lighting applications. This breakthrough paved the way for the creation of LED Tubes, which quickly gained popularity due to their energy-saving and environmental benefits.

Technology Behind LED Tubes

LED Tubes are essentially a collection of high-efficiency LEDs mounted on a single, long tube. The technology behind these tubes involves several key components:

  • LED Chips: These are the tiny semiconductor devices that emit light when an electric current passes through them. The quality and efficiency of the LED chips significantly impact the performance of the LED Tube.
  • Heat Sink: Since LEDs generate heat when they operate, a heat sink is used to dissipate this heat and maintain the LED's temperature within safe limits. This prolongs the lifespan of the LED Tube.
  • Driver: The driver is an electronic device that converts the input voltage to the voltage required by the LEDs. It ensures that the LEDs receive a stable and consistent power supply.
  • Reflector: The reflector is designed to direct the emitted light towards the desired direction, maximizing the illumination efficiency of the LED Tube.

Modern LED Tubes come in various colors, including white, red, blue, and green, and can be customized to meet specific lighting requirements. The color and intensity of the light are determined by the type of LED chips used and the reflector design.

Benefits of LED Tubes

LED Tubes offer several advantages over traditional lighting solutions:

  • Energy Efficiency: LED Tubes consume significantly less energy than incandescent, halogen, and fluorescent bulbs, leading to lower electricity bills and reduced greenhouse gas emissions.
  • Longevity: LED Tubes have a much longer lifespan than traditional bulbs, lasting up to 25 times longer. This reduces the frequency of bulb replacements and maintenance costs.
  • Cost Savings: The combination of energy efficiency and longevity results in substantial cost savings over the lifetime of the LED Tube.
  • Environmental Benefits: LED Tubes are free of harmful substances like mercury, making them an environmentally friendly choice.
  • Customization: LED Tubes can be customized to emit different colors and intensities of light, allowing for creative and flexible lighting designs.
